What are Destroying Habits?

Destroying habits are those habits that, one's physical, mental, and emotional well-being. They can lead to health problems, stress, missed opportunities, and damaged relationships. Examples of such habits include procrastination, negative thinking, lack of self-care, poor time management, lack of communication, comparing oneself to others, not setting goals, living beyond one's means, not learning from mistakes, and not being grateful. These habits can be detrimental to one's overall quality of life and should be addressed and replaced with positive habits.

Habits That Destroying Your Life

  1. Procrastination: Putting off important tasks can lead to stress and missed opportunities.
  2. Negative thinking: Constantly focusing on the negative can lead to depression and anxiety.
  3. Lack of self-care: Neglecting self-care can lead to physical and mental health issues.
  4. Poor time management: Being disorganized and failing to prioritize can lead to missed deadlines and increased stress.
  5. Lack of communication: Avoiding communication can lead to misunderstandings and damaged relationships.
  6. Comparing yourself to others: Constant comparison can lead to feelings of inadequacy and low self-esteem.
  7. Not setting goals: Without goals, you may lack direction and purpose.
  8. Living beyond your means: Excessive spending can lead to financial problems and debt.
  9. Not learning from your mistakes: Repeating the same mistakes can prevent you from growing and improving.
  10. Not being grateful: Focusing on what you lack instead of what you have can lead to dissatisfaction and unhappiness.
  11. Lack of sleep: Chronic sleep deprivation can lead to fatigue, irritability, and a weakened immune system.
  12. Social media addiction: Spending excessive time on social media can lead to feelings of loneliness and isolation.
  13. Smoking: A smoking habit can lead to lung cancer, heart disease, and other serious health problems.
  14. Overeating: Consistently eating more food than the body needs can lead to weight gain and obesity-related health problems.
  15. Chronic multitasking: Trying to do too many things at once can lead to decreased productivity and increased stress.
  16. Holding grudges: Holding onto resentment can lead to negative emotions and damage relationships.
  17. Lack of boundaries: Not setting healthy boundaries can lead to stress and burnout.
  18. Not taking responsibility: Avoiding responsibility for one's actions can lead to a lack of personal growth and progress.
  19. Financial mismanagement: Failing to budget and manage money can lead to financial problems.
  20. Avoiding change: Resisting change can prevent personal growth and development.
  21. Self-sabotage: Engaging in behaviors that undermine one's own success, such as procrastination or self-doubt.
  22. Perfectionism: Having unrealistic expectations of oneself can lead to stress and dissatisfaction.
  23. Lack of focus: Having difficulty focusing on important tasks can lead to decreased productivity and missed opportunities.
  24. Gossiping: Spreading rumors or sharing private information can damage relationships and harm reputations.
  25. Disorganization: Having a cluttered and disorganized environment can lead to increased stress and decreased productivity.
  26. Ignoring red flags: Failing to pay attention to warning signs in relationships or other areas of life can lead to negative consequences.
  27. Not learning new skills: Failing to continue learning and developing new skills can lead to missed opportunities and a lack of career advancement.
  28. Not seeking help: Failing to seek help for mental health or personal issues can prevent one from getting the support and assistance they need.
  29. Resistance to feedback: Avoiding feedback or failing to take it constructively can hinder personal growth and progress.
  30. Not setting priorities: Failing to prioritize important tasks and responsibilities can lead to missed deadlines and increased stress.
  31. Blaming others: Constantly blaming others for one's own problems can prevent personal growth and progress.
  32. Not taking action: Failing to take action toward one's goals and aspirations can lead to a lack of progress and dissatisfaction.
  33. Being too hard on yourself: Constantly criticizing oneself can lead to low self-esteem and negative self-talk.
  34. Not being assertive: Failing to assert oneself in situations can lead to missed opportunities and a lack of personal power.
  35. Ignoring intuition: Failing to listen to one's intuition can lead to making poor decisions.
  36. Not being present: Failing to be present in the moment and constantly thinking about the past or future can lead to stress and dissatisfaction.
  37. Not valuing personal time: Failing to prioritize personal time for self-care and relaxation can lead to burnout.
  38. Not maintaining relationships: Failing to nurture and maintain important relationships can lead to feelings of loneliness and isolation.
